DN2540N3-G-P003 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

  • For optimal performance, it's recommended to follow the PCB layout guidelines provided in the datasheet, ensuring a solid ground plane, and using thermal vias to dissipate heat. A 4-layer PCB with a dedicated power plane and a solid ground plane is recommended. Additionally, consider using thermal interface materials and heat sinks to manage temperature.
  • To ensure EMC and reduce EMI, follow the recommended PCB layout, use a shielded enclosure, and implement proper grounding and shielding techniques. Additionally, consider using EMI filters, ferrite beads, and shielding components to minimize radiation and susceptibility.
  • The recommended power-up sequence is to apply the power supply voltage (VCC) first, followed by the input voltage (VIN). For power-down, reverse the sequence. Ensure that the power supply voltage is stable before applying the input voltage. Refer to the datasheet for specific timing requirements.
  • Use a logic analyzer or oscilloscope to monitor the device's signals and verify that the input and output signals meet the datasheet specifications. Check the power supply voltage, input voltage, and output voltage for any anomalies. Consult the datasheet and application notes for troubleshooting guidelines and common pitfalls to avoid.
  • The device has a maximum junction temperature (TJ) of 150°C. Derate the power dissipation by 2.5mW/°C above 25°C. Ensure proper thermal management, such as using heat sinks and thermal interface materials, to maintain a safe operating temperature.

About Microchip

Microchip Technology Inc. is a leading manufacturer of microcontrollers and semiconductor devices for a wide range of applications in the aerospace, automotive, consumer electronics, industrial, and medical industries. Alongside a comprehensive product portfolio, Microchip Technology Inc. also provides easy-to-use development tools that enable engineers to create optimal designs quickly with minimal iterations to reduce risk while lowering total system costs to market.
